All: On AMC do you think the character of Erica Kane

Featured Replies

  • Member

When Agnes Nixon pitched her AMc soap bible to the networks in 1965,she was turned down.But when Nixon became the headwriter for AW in 1967 she created the character of Rachel Davis who was patterned after the Erica Kane character on AMC.Both characters wanted to have success and wealth and life.But there is one difference Rachel Davis was allowed to grow up and evolve and had began to have her dreams of wealth and success come true and had evolved into the show's matriarch in later years and was apart of the glue that held AW together even after Mac's passing in 1989.The same cannot be said for the Erica Kane character on AMC.I don't think I ever seen a character so self-centered and childish refusing to learn from her mistakes for onceand learn to grow up.On AW ,the birth Ada McGowan's late-in-life child Nancy was apart of a turning point for Rachel.There seems to have been no real turning point in the character of Erica to make her grow up.Not even the death of her mother Mona has seemed to make the character grow up.I place the blame on writers,producers,and the network executives for the lack of transformation.I think it would be more engaging to the viewers and fans if the other characters were written in such a way by not being an enabler for Erica's childish antics by having the whole town turn against her to make see herself and then lose the money and fortune she has appeared to work for all these years.Why not let Erica age gracefully not having her fawn over man in town over the age of 21.

I don't really see in what ways Erica needs to mature or act her age or evolve. I mean, if she were a real person, it'd be nice for her to be less flighty and self-centered, but those are character traits without which she wouldn't be particularly interesting.

She has grown in some ways. She's fully committed to Jack and doesn't put her interests ahead of his in the same selfish way that she used to with men. She's fiercely protective of her family.

It's not as though they have her in a triangle with Aiden and Ryan. Her current story is a family-centered, history-based one (rewritten and shat-upon history aside). I don't want to see her become some watered-down matriarch who has nothing to do but wring her hands and pray.
